Prayer of Restoration and Regeneration

Heavenly Father, I come to You with every broken piece of my life.
You see what no one else sees. You know the depth of my wounds.
And yet, You love me deeply and completely.

Titus 3:5 (NLT) “He washed away our sins, giving us a new birth and new life through the Holy Spirit.”

Lord, I ask for complete restoration in my soul.
Heal what was damaged by trauma—mine and the trauma passed down to me.
I surrender every generational wound to You now.

Isaiah 61:3 (NLT) “To all who mourn… He will give a crown of beauty for ashes, a joyous blessing instead of mourning, festive praise instead of despair.”

God, breathe new life into the areas of my heart that feel dead.
Let regeneration flow through me—spirit, soul, and body.
Make me whole again.

Father, restore the years the enemy tried to steal.
Regenerate my joy. My faith. My identity in You.
Let Your Spirit renew every part of me.

In Jesus’ mighty name, Amen.

Bible Verses for Restoration and Regeneration

Titus 3:5 (NLT)
He washed away our sins, giving us a new birth and new life through the Holy Spirit.”

Isaiah 61:3 (NLT)
To all who mourn… He will give a crown of beauty for ashes, a joyous blessing instead of mourning, festive praise instead of despair.”

Joel 2:25 (NLT)
“The Lord says, ‘I will give you back what you lost to the swarming locusts…’”

2 Corinthians 5:17 (NLT)
“Anyone who belongs to Christ has become a new person. The old life is gone; a new life has begun!”

FAQ

How do I pray for restoration and healing from past trauma?

Start by bringing your broken pieces honestly to God, acknowledging the wounds He sees. Ask Him to heal both your personal trauma and any generational pain passed down to you. Surrender these hurts to Him daily, speak declarations of restoration out loud, and trust that the Holy Spirit can regenerate the dead places in your heart. Writing down specific areas needing healing helps anchor your faith in God's power to make you whole again.

What does it mean to be regenerated spiritually?

Spiritual regeneration means God doesn't just patch your wounds—He breathes new life into places that feel dead or broken. It's a complete renewal of your spirit, soul, and body through the power of the Holy Spirit. Rather than staying stuck in pain, regeneration allows you to become a new person with restored joy, faith, and identity in Christ, free from the past's grip on your future.

Can generational trauma be healed through prayer?

Yes. The Bible teaches that generational wounds can be surrendered to God for healing and restoration. When you bring these inherited hurts to God in prayer, you're asking Him to break the cycle and heal not just your pain but the roots running back through your family line. God's restoration is powerful enough to transform what the enemy meant to steal, giving you freedom that extends beyond yourself.

Why do I still hurt even though time has passed?

Unhealed trauma delays your destiny and dims your identity because wounds that aren't addressed spiritually don't automatically fade with time. You may function outwardly while something inside remains stuck, especially when trauma is deep or inherited. God's invitation is to stop just managing the pain and start receiving His actual healing—allowing Him to restore you completely from the inside out.
